GOOGLE ADSENSE
AdSense is an advertising program run by Google that delivers relevant text and image advertisements that are precisely targeted to a participating web site’s content so as to be relevant and useful to the visitors of that site. AdSense is Google's syndication service for its AdWords ads. Currently AdSense uses JavaScript code to incorporate the advertisement into a participating site.
Web site owners displaying such ads are paid whenever visitors click on them. Owners can also filter out specific competitors or specific advertisers. Advertisers can bid to appear on a particular site on a CPC (cost per click) or CPM (cost per thousand impressions) basis.
AdSense for search - allows web site owners to provide Google web search and site search to their visitors. This enables the site owner to earn money by displaying relevant Google ads targeted to the search results generated by the visitor’s search request.
